Portable vehicle interior heater
Description
FIG. 1 is a front elevational view of the portable vehicle interior heater of the present invention;
FIG. 2 is a back elevational view of the portable vehicle interior heater of FIG. 1;
FIG. 3 is a left side elevational view of the portable vehicle interior heater of FIG. 1;
FIG. 4 is a right side elevational view of the portable vehicle interior heater of FIG. 1;
FIG. 5 is a top plan view of the portable vehicle interior heater of FIG. 1; and,
FIG. 6 is a bottom plan view of the portable vehicle interior heater of FIG. 1.
The cord is shown broken away to indicate indeterminate length.
